What are the differences between a tick and a beetle in terms of their physical characteristics and behavior?

Ticks and beetles are both small arthropods, but they have distinct differences in their physical characteristics and behavior. Ticks are parasitic arachnids that feed on the blood of animals, while beetles are insects with hard outer shells and diverse diets. Ticks have a flat body and specialized mouthparts for feeding, while beetles have a more rounded body and chewing mouthparts. In terms of behavior, ticks are known for attaching themselves to hosts for extended periods, while beetles are more active and can be found in various habitats feeding on plants, fungi, or other insects.

Is a dog tick arachnid?

Ticks are small arachnids in the order Parasitiformes. Along with mites, they constitute the subclass Acari. The family of ticks on dogs is Ixodidae (Hard Ticks).
